Who is appointed as the leader of the House in Rajya Sabha?

AThe leader of opposition party

BPrime Minister or a Minister, who is a member of Rajya Sabha nominated by the Prime Minister

CA senior member nominated by the Chairman of the House

DA member of the House elected by majority of the House

Answer:

B. Prime Minister or a Minister, who is a member of Rajya Sabha nominated by the Prime Minister

Read Explanation:

  • The Leader of the House in Rajya Sabha is a pivotal figure.

    • Option A (Leader of opposition party): This describes the Leader of the Opposition, not the Leader of the House.

    • Option B (Prime Minister or a Minister...): This is the correct definition. If the Prime Minister is a member of the Rajya Sabha, they can be the Leader of the House. Otherwise, the Prime Minister nominates a minister who is a member of the Rajya Sabha to be the Leader of the House. This minister is usually a senior and influential figure in the government.

    • Option C (A senior member nominated by the Chairman): The Chairman (Vice President) does not nominate the Leader of the House; it's a government appointment.

    • Option D (A member... elected by majority): This is not how the Leader of the House is chosen. It's a nomination by the Prime Minister.
